Energy Vault Holdings Inc. (NRGV) has released its first quarter 2026 financial results, reporting revenue of $203.67 million and a loss per share of $0.20. The quarterly performance reflects the company's ongoing strategic initiatives aimed at positioning itself for long-term growth within the evolving energy storage sector. Management Commentary
Leadership at Energy discussed the quarter's progress in their commentary, emphasizing the company's commitment to executing its strategic vision while managing operating expenses. Management highlighted ongoing commercial activities and partnerships that may support future revenue growth. The company has been pursuing a disciplined approach to expansion, focusing on markets where its energy storage technology may address specific grid needs.
The executive team acknowledged the competitive landscape in renewable energy storage, noting that market dynamics continue to evolve as utility companies and grid operators increasingly evaluate various storage technologies. Energy has positioned its gravity storage systems as an alternative to lithium-ion batteries for long-duration applications, though widespread adoption remains in early stages.
Management indicated that development projects currently in progress may contribute to future periods, with commercial deployments potentially increasing as the year progresses. The company maintained its focus on project pipeline development while working to optimize its cost structure.

Forward Guidance
Energy has provided outlook information regarding its expectations for the remainder of 2026. The company indicated it anticipates continued investment in its technology platform and commercial expansion. Management discussed expectations for revenue recognition from projects currently in various stages of development, though the timing of such revenue may be subject to factors including regulatory approvals, financing completion, and construction timelines.
The company expects operating expenses to remain elevated as it supports its growing project pipeline and advances research and development activities. Energy has guided that it may require additional capital to fund its operations and expansion plans, though management has expressed confidence in the company's ability to access financing markets.
Energy indicated it may pursue strategic partnerships and customer agreements that could support its growth objectives. The company noted it would provide updates as commercial milestones are achieved throughout the year.
